Key Features to Consider
When picking a portable treadmill with incline, numerous features should be considered:
Incline Range: Look for designs that use adjustable inclines, enabling for different workout intensities. The majority of treadmills offer inclines in between 0% to 15%.
Weight Capacity: Ensure that the treadmill can support your weight. The majority of designs have weight limitations in between 220 to 300 pounds.
Running Surface: A spacious running location boosts comfort during workouts. Typical dimensions range from 16" to 20" in width and 40" to 60" in length.
Display and Control Panel: An easy to use interface with easy-to-read metrics can enhance the exercise experience.
Foldability and Portability: Check if the treadmill can quickly fold for storage and whether it includes wheels for simpler mobility.
Warranty: A solid service warranty can provide you assurance about your investment. Look for guarantees covering a minimum of one year for parts and extra coverage on motor and frame.

Do I need to perform upkeep on my portable treadmill?
Yes, regular upkeep, such as lubing the deck, inspecting the incline mechanism, and keeping the machine tidy, is advised to make sure the durability of your portable treadmill.
Can I use a portable treadmill with incline for walking and running?
Absolutely! Lots of portable treadmills with incline functions are flexible enough for both walking and running, making them appropriate for users of various physical fitness levels.
How do I select the ideal incline for my workout?
Start at a lower incline if you are a novice and slowly increase it as your physical fitness level enhances. An incline of 1-3% appropriates for a walking exercise, while a 5-10% incline can provide a reliable difficulty for running.
Are there any security considerations when using a portable treadmill?
Always guarantee that the treadmill is set up on a flat surface and that you follow the producer's instructions. Furthermore, use the security secret and start by walking before transitioning to running.
